**Ticket: Feedwright validator rejects valid enclosure lengths**

New team members: the Feedwright podcast validator flags enclosures whose byte length exceeds 2 GB, even though the spec permits them. Workaround is to skip the length check via the lenient flag. Fix is staged in the validator branch; the associated build token is recorded below.

session token of tajef-bageg = htk21_5d90d574934f3ccae6437

### Changed Defaults: Contrast Audit Fallout

Heads up, reviewer — after the Mosslight accessibility audit, our theme defaults shifted. Minimum contrast ratio is now enforced at build time, the muted-gray palette got darkened, and low-contrast warnings fail CI instead of just nagging. Most diffs in this PR are mechanical token swaps. The theme service now ships with these defaults.

settings of kagup-tagug:
ULAIX_HOST=ulaix.zemvarsys.internal
ULAIX_PORT=8000

## Consent banner rollout — on-call notes

Welcome aboard! The Murmur consent banner is rolling out region by region, and you're the safety net. If opt-in rates crater or the banner fails to render, the usual culprit is the geo-config service returning stale region flags. You can flip a region back to the previous banner version through the Lanternfish admin CLI — no deploy needed. The CLI talks to the internal rollout service, and you'll authenticate with the key just below.

gateway credential: kto23_dolYgAScEh2TaPOlStqOl98

## ProfileCore Environments

Sharding of the user-profile store lands in staging this week. Lookup keys now hash across eight shards; legacy single-node reads stay enabled behind a flag until cutover. Rebalance jobs run nightly in the Vexhall cluster. QA owns verification of cross-shard pagination. No prod changes until sign-off at next sync. The staging shard map and related settings are as follows.

service settings:
WENATH_PIN=5007
WENATH_METRICS_HOST=metrics.wenath.tolvaqlabs.corp
WENATH_LOG_LEVEL=debug
WENATH_TENANT=rusox